Braille Reading Pals: A Pre-reader’s Program
Wednesday, 18 October 2006

Braille Reading Pals, a non-competitive Braille readiness program for blind infants, toddlers, preschoolers, and older students with reading delays, begins November 1 and runs through December 31.
